Alexander McQueen’s Autumn/Winter 1996 collection was held in a candle-lit church in London built in 1729 by a suspected Satanist. Entitled ‘Dante’, and dedicated to Isabella Blow, the collection was named for the 14th Century Italian poet Dante Alighieri whose Divine Comedy portrays an allegorical vision of the afterlife. The runway took on the shape of a cross, and featured a skeleton as a macabre front row guest placed intentionally next to Suzy Menkes whom McQueen famously disliked. The press were anxious to see what McQueen would present in a place of worship - they were not disappointed.

Beauty and blasphemy were woven throughout the collection which McQueen described as a commentary on “war and peace through the years...I think religion has caused every war in the world, which is why I showed it in a church.” Religious iconography and brutal images of conflict abounded; images of the Vietnam war were printed on jackets, coats and tops, creating poignant contrast to the luxurious fabrics beneath. Intermingled amongst it all, McQueen harnessed the energy of British street culture by pairing his creations with frayed and bleached denims.

Three days after the show, WWD hailed McQueen as “the saviour of London Fashion Week”, and it was subsequently presented twice - the second time in a disused synagogue in New York which was so packed that even Anna Wintour couldn’t get in. McQueen would take the helm of Givenchy later that year.

This blouse's pinstripe pattern featured heavily throughout the show. Similar blues and lilacs were colours of traditional Victorian ‘half mourning’, signifying McQueen’s ability to find beauty in death; a notion also observable in the blouse’s delicate semi-sheer silk structure. A powerful exaggerated high collar - another reference to traditional mourning wear - is balanced with delicate feminine tailoring. Extended vertical darts panel down the front and back creating an hourglass figure, while a long curved hem exposes the upper leg on either side.
